Here are the 10 Math Homework Help Apps Every Student Must Know!

1. Photomath: Your Math Tutor

Photomath is a game-changer for students who want to understand the step-by-step solutions to math problems. Simply take a picture of your handwritten or printed math q, and the app instantly provides a detailed explanation. It’s like having a personal math tutor in your pocket.

2. Khan Academy: Master Math at Your Own Pace

Khan Academy offers an extensive library of video lessons and interactive exercises covering a wide range of math topics. Whether you need help with basic arithmetic or advanced calculus, Khan Academy provides clear and concise explanations that cater to your learning pace.

3. Wolfram Alpha: The Ultimate Math Computational Engine

Wolfram Alpha is a powerful computational engine that can solve complex math problems, plot graphs, and provide in-depth answers. It’s an indispensable tool for students in higher-level math courses or those pursuing STEM degrees.

4. Microsoft Math Solver: Math Assistance Made Easy

Microsoft Math Solver is a user-friendly app that not only provides solutions but also explains the steps to solve math problems. It covers a broad spectrum of math topics, making it suitable for students from middle school to college.

5. Photomath Plus: Go Beyond the Basics

Photomath Plus is the premium version of Photomath, offering additional features like textbook solutions and expert explanations. If you’re looking to take your math comprehension to the next level, this app is worth the investment.

6. GeoGebra: Interactive Math Learning

GeoGebra is an interactive math app that combines geometry, algebra, spreadsheets, graphing, and statistics. It’s an ideal choice for visual learners who prefer hands-on experiences to grasp mathematical concepts.

7. Cymath: Simplify Your Math Problems

Cymath specializes in solving algebraic equations. Simply enter the equation, and the app provides step-by-step solutions. It’s a valuable tool for students navigating the complexities of algebra.

8. Brilliant.org: Enhance Your Problem-Solving Skills

Brilliant.org offers a wide range of interactive courses and quizzes in math and science. It’s an excellent platform to challenge your problem-solving skills and deepen your understanding of mathematical concepts.

9. MyScript Calculator: Write It Out

MyScript Calculator allows you to solve math problems by handwriting them on your device’s screen. It recognizes your handwriting and provides instant results, making it an intuitive choice for those who prefer writing to typing.

10. Desmos: Graphing Made Easy

Desmos is a graphing calculator app that simplifies the process of creating and exploring graphs. Whether you’re working on algebraic equations or plotting functions, Desmos is a user-friendly tool that can help you visualize mathematical concepts.

FAQs

Are these math homework help apps free to use?

Some of these apps offer free versions with limited features, while others require a subscription for full access. Check their respective websites for pricing details.

Do these apps work on both Android and iOS devices?

Yes, the majority of these apps are available for both Android and iOS platforms.

Are these apps suitable for students of all ages?

Yes, these apps cater to students from middle school to college and beyond, so they can benefit learners of all ages.

Can these apps replace traditional math textbooks?

While these apps provide valuable assistance, they are best used in conjunction with textbooks and classroom instruction for a comprehensive learning experience.

Do these apps require an internet connection to function?

Most of these apps require an internet connection for initial setup and updates, but some may offer offline features for specific tasks. Be sure to check their requirements.
